Chickie Wah Wah
Sun, 16 Nov, 2025 at 01:30 am - Mon, 17 Nov, 2025 at 01:30 am (CST)
Chickie Wah Wah
2828 Canal Street, New Orleans, LA 70119, US, United States
Also check out other Contests in New Orleans, Trips & Adventurous Activities in New Orleans.
Tickets for Jeff Tweedy can be booked here.